Marmot Gear Reviews

Marmot Aiguille Dryloft

This cool-looking sleeping bag offers an explosion of warmth on cold nights. With this tough, water-resistant, - 5 degree, 800-fill down bag, you may never sleep cold again.
 

Marmot DriClime Windshirt

What the heck is a wind shirt? Think of it as a windbreaker with a wicking layer. But why on earth do you need one? Because they are one of the most versatile pieces of clothing you can wear. Find out all about the Marmot DriClime Windshirt in this review.
 

Marmot Liquid Steel Jacket

Want to keep dry under the cruelest weather Mother Nature can throw your way? If so, then the ultra light-weight Liquid Steel Jacket, with its 3-layer XCR Gore-Tex Shell should be at the top of your "to-buy" list.

Marmot Liquid Steel Pants

If you want your top protected from vicious weather, then you will also want your bottom (oops, legs) protected as well. Marmot's matching Liquid Steel Pants are just the right match for the Marmot's Liquid Steel Jacket.
 

Marmot Meteor Jacket

Waterproof, breathable shells don't have to cost a fortune, or weigh a lot. The new Meteor technical shell from Marmot proves both these points.
